Robert Parker Score: 97+ points
Reviewer: Erin Larkin — December 2023 Week 25 Jun 2025
Drink 2025–2052
The 2022 Coleraine is a blend of 84% Cabernet Sauvignon, 13% Merlot and 3% Cabernet Franc. On the nose, the wine shows its sweet creamy oak, a cavalcade of dark fruit and an array of spices. The wine is powdery and ultra fine, with a gravelly score of tannin woven through the finish. A spectacular wine, it's still looking so primary and young at this early stage. I note the total acidity is akin to the 2013 vintage, and it serves to add an extra layer of freshness to the finish—a little uptick to close, if you will. This is awesome. It gets better every time I taste it. 13.5% alcohol, sealed under natural cork.
